Interior heater/AC fan squeak
Does anybody know if the interior cab fan on a 2002 yukon can be serviced i.e. lubricated, to stop a squeak/squeel sound? If so, how do you get at it? Thanks

Re: Interior heater/AC fan squeak
it sounds like you'll have to replace the fan motor. it's located under the dash on the right side. there is a few screws that hold the lower trim panel on and then a cover over the motor. the motor assy. is not screwed into anything it has a lock tab that needs to be released and the motor will need to be turned by hand about a half turn. the motor will drop right out after the wiring is disconnected. i just did this on my 02, i bought a new fan assy. off e-bay for about $65 shipped.
